学 C++的练习有什么

2015-07-03 17:31:51 +08:00
 johnny1996
help,最近在啃c++ primer plus 6th 。课后练习也做了,有没有其他的有关c++编程练习的书,求推荐

ps:我不知道发哪个节点,深思熟虑后,发这儿了。。。。
7426 次点击
所在节点    程序员
32 条回复
alphonsez
2015-07-04 08:42:16 +08:00
如果为了面试呢,算法练习是最好的了,上面给了一大堆ACM的你慢慢刷。leetcode的习题你也可以玩玩。

如果是语法/工程向的呢,写几个自己感兴趣的小东西玩玩吧。比如,写个没有人工智能的黑白棋,纯粹console输出的。或者写一个小计算器,读入一个算式输出结果。
alphonsez
2015-07-04 08:47:02 +08:00
入门习题书呢也可以看看这个:
http://book.douban.com/subject/1231977/

不知道现在哪里还有得卖了。但不如自己多写多读来的实在。注意还要多读,光写烂代码不读好代码也容易毁。
Nicksxs
2015-07-04 10:14:43 +08:00
不是应该看C++ primer么
canautumn
2015-07-04 10:20:31 +08:00
这本书比C++ Primer不知差到哪里去了。
endrollex
2015-07-04 11:20:17 +08:00
C++ primer必读
laduary
2015-07-04 12:20:47 +08:00
onemoo
2015-07-04 13:24:43 +08:00
做游戏 +1 当然这只是我的兴趣方向
还有像楼上几位说的,你更应该看《C++ primer》,而且起码要>=C++11。
不建议直接去刷题,或者你至少应该把算法的书看了,比如《数据结构与算法分析 C++描述》

另外,学C才是看《C primer plus》
jsyangwenjie
2015-07-04 15:55:07 +08:00
我教你,先把语法弄懂了
http://web.stanford.edu/class/cs106x/index.html
上这个网站,把slides都看了,然后把作业做掉。
你就有stanford大一学生的水平了。

不要听他们的去刷OJ,做XX项目
太盲目,投入产出比太低。
ksex
2015-07-04 16:35:40 +08:00
看看那些经典的书籍推荐《 C++ primer》,还有就是做项目!
学习使用一些常见的库!
一些C++资源 http://codecloud.net/c-plus-plus-resource-2983.html
多写多练才是王道
johnny1996
2015-07-04 17:20:53 +08:00
@jsyangwenjie 这东西怎么用,看得有点吃力啊。。。。。
jsyangwenjie
2015-07-04 20:39:28 +08:00
@johnny1996 看assignment里面是怎么做的,下载下来,写,写一个assignment就是一个几百行的小项目了。
英语不行就硬着头皮啃,没办法
johnny1996
2015-07-05 08:01:03 +08:00
@jsyangwenjie thanks

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/203122

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X